0

cronjob でクエリ製品からすべての Stock を削除しようとしています:

List<ProductModel> products = flexibleSearchService.search(GET_SPECIAL_PRODUCTS_QUERY);

for (ProductModel product : products.getResult()) {
     modelService.removeAll(product.getStockLevels());
}

ここでデバッグすると、すべての製品に在庫があることがわかりますが、モデル サービスから removeAll メソッドを実行した後、在庫は削除されません。

どうすればこれを修正できますか?

4

0 に答える 0